Why Is Psychiatry Important?

Psychiatry is a branch of medication concentrated on diagnosing, dealing with, and avoiding mental health conditions. These disorders can range from stress and anxiety and anxiety to more serious conditions like bipolar condition and schizophrenia. Psychiatrists are trained to comprehend the intricacies of mental health, supplying treatment, medication, and typically a combination of both to deal with a patient's needs.

Steps to Finding a Psychiatrist Near You

Finding a psychiatrist can feel overwhelming, particularly if you're unsure where to begin. Here are some simple actions to guide you in your search:

  1. Identify Your Needs: Consider what kind of assistance you require. This might consist of treatment, medication, or both.

  2. Seek Recommendations: Ask trusted good friends, household, or health care suppliers for referrals. Individual experiences can be important.

  3. Utilize Online Resources: Websites like Psychology Today, Zocdoc, or Healthgrades offer directories of mental health professionals, including their specialties and patient evaluations.

  4. Check Availability and Insurance: Once you have a list of possible psychiatrists, verify their schedule and whether they accept your insurance strategy.

  5. Schedule an Initial Consultation: Many psychiatrists use an introductory assessment. This conference can assist you examine whether you feel comfortable with the psychiatrist's technique.

  6. Examine Compatibility: After your first couple of sessions, assess your experiences. Convenience and trust are essential in the therapeutic relationship.

Common Mental Health Disorders Treated by Psychiatrists

Psychiatrists can deal with a variety of mental health issues. Some of the most common ones consist of:

  1. Anxiety Disorders: These include generalized stress and anxiety disorder (GAD), panic attack, and social stress and anxiety disorder, defined by extreme worry and worry.

  2. Depression: This mood condition involves relentless unhappiness, loss of interest, and a variety of emotional and physical problems.

  3. Bipolar affective disorder: Marked by severe mood swings, this condition affects energy levels and day-to-day performance.

  4. Schizophrenia: This extreme mental condition can impact how an individual thinks, feels, and behaves, frequently involving hallucinations and deceptions.

  5.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der (OCD): OCD is identified by undesirable, persistent ideas (obsessions) and repetitive behaviors (obsessions).

  6.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D): This condition can happen after experiencing or witnessing a terrible occasion.

FAQ: Understanding Psychiatry

Q1: What credentials do psychiatrists need?

Psychiatrists are medical doctors who total medical school and a residency in psychiatry. They are likewise required to have a license to practice medicine and may pursue board accreditation.

Q2: How are psychiatrists different from psychologists?

While both experts concentrate on mental health, psychiatrists can recommend medication and are trained to carry out physical exams and order laboratory tests, whereas psychologists usually supply treatment and counseling.

Q3: What should I anticipate throughout my first go to?

During your very first appointment, the psychiatrist will likely ask about your whole case history, signs, and any medications you currently take. This info helps them create a tailored treatment prepare for you.

Q4: Is psychiatric treatment reliable?

Yes, research study shows that psychiatric treatments, consisting of therapy and medication, can efficiently decrease symptoms and enhance lifestyle for many people.

Q5: How long does treatment generally last?

The duration of treatment differs depending upon the individual and their specific condition. Some might take advantage of short-term treatment, while others might need ongoing support for many years.
